UNM prioritizes campus accessibility

Last month, The University of New Mexico announced that they were expanding their accessibility efforts for their students, faculty, staff, and community members on the main campus in Albuquerque.

“Accessibility is only the first step as we’re moving towards universal design, which is looking at everything you do in a way that isn’t just helpful for people with disabilities but is also for different learning styles, ages, and abilities – and building that into every decision we make,” said UNM Chief Compliance Officer & ADA Coordinator, Francie Cordova.

UNM engaged TPGi to assess the accessibility of their website, digital assets, policies and also provide accessibility training to their team of web designers and developers.
